Talking Stones at the Rhine Museum: A Journey into the Devon Sea

With Talking Stones – The Devon Sea, the Rhine Museum Koblenz opens a fascinating window into a time when a shallow sea existed where the Rhine flows today. The special exhibition combines fossil finds, photographs, and geological exploration into an educational experience for families, explorers, and anyone who wants to not just see but feel natural history.

When Stones Tell Stories

The exhibition takes visitors on a journey through 400 million years of Earth history. Petrified organisms, marine deposits, and images by Klaus Hammerl reveal how alive the past remains in the rock layers of the Rhenish Slate Mountains. Visit with Practical Comfort

The Rhine Museum is located in Koblenz-Ehrenbreitstein, diagonally across from the Koblenz-Ehrenbreitstein train station, below the Ehrenbreitstein Fortress. There is a visitor parking lot behind the museum. The building is largely accessible via the elevator; additionally, a barrier-free toilet is available upon request. According to museum information, payment is currently only accepted in cash, card payment is not possible.
